The brief

Open procurement process was undertaken to award a 5.5 year contract with the option to extend up to two years.

The end date, and highest value of the contract of £13.5m (£1.8m per annum), represents the full 7.5 years of the contract (including extension).

The aim of the service is to implement Extended Access in accordance with the NHS England mandated specification.

The service is to contribute to primary care delivery within the ERY locality offering routine and pre-bookable appointments to patients 7 days a week and 365 days a year.

The expected outcomes of this service are: a) Ensuring all patients can access same day and pre-bookable appointments in primary care 7 days a week b) Improved patient satisfaction with access to primary care c) Reduce inequalities in patient access to primary care d) Creating a more sustainable primary care operating with manageable workloads and under reduced workload pressure e) Reduced number of patients with a primary care problems seen in A&E or Urgent Care f) A pattern of extended hours that best fits local demand and that responds flexibly to patient needs as measured through the use of new demand monitoring tools. g) Greater individual empowerment and self care via education and information through a range of methods, including notification on practice websites, notices in local urgent care services and publicity into the community
